There are three ways to prove triangle similar

  1. AA similar theorem--Two corresponding angles in two triangles are the congruent
  2. SAS similar theorem--Two corresponding pairs of sides of two triangles are proportional, and the angle in between two sides are congruent
  3. SSS similar theorem--All corresponding sides of two triangles are proportional
